What's the best time of year to book my B&B in Butternut?
When you’re dreaming of a escape to Butternut,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 19°F. The snowiest months in Butternut are April, March, February, and January, with each month seeing an average of 9 inches of snowfall.
What is there to do in Butternut?
Spend some time exploring Flambeau River and Turtle Flambeau Flowage if you’re hoping to see some of the area’s natural features. You might check out Chequamegon National Forest if you have time to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Butternut?
Planning your excursions in and around Butternut is easier with these transportation options. Fly into Ironwood, MI (IWD-Gogebic County), which is located 39.2 mi (63.1 km) from the city center. If you’d like to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
